IoT connectivity in building automation techniques represents a transformative leap in how we handle and optimize our constructed environments. The integration of IoT expertise allows for real-time monitoring and management of various building methods similar to HVAC, lighting, safety, and even energy consumption. These advancements lead to enhanced energy efficiency, improved occupant consolation, and streamlined facility administration.


The rise of smart buildings exemplifies the significant potential of IoT connectivity. With sensors embedded all through the infrastructure, data is continuously collected and analyzed. This data-driven approach permits building managers to make informed selections about working situations and resource allocation. Predictive maintenance is certainly one of the key purposes, allowing for the identification of potential tools failures earlier than they happen, thereby reducing downtime and maintenance prices.

Connectivity in building automation fosters a extra responsive environment. By using cloud technologies and cell purposes, customers can work together with constructing systems from wherever. This remote entry empowers facility managers and occupants alike to adjust settings, obtain alerts, and analyze performance metrics. Such capabilities contribute to a extra agile and adaptable constructing, able to meeting altering wants.


Another facet of IoT connectivity in constructing automation is the integration of superior analytics. By harnessing data analytics, building managers can gain insights into usage patterns and system efficiency. This fosters a culture of continuous enchancment, the place decisions are pushed by real-time information rather than assumptions. Consequently, buildings may be optimized for energy use, resulting in lower operating costs and a reduced environmental footprint.

Security is another crucial component enhanced by IoT connectivity. Smart constructing systems can communicate with each other, offering comprehensive surveillance and access control measures - Remote Monitoring Of Iot Devices. IoT-enabled cameras, alarms, and locks work together to create a safe environment with out compromising comfort. Building managers can monitor security feeds and obtain alerts directly to their devices, allowing for prompt action in case of emergencies.


The role of IoT connectivity extends beyond operational efficiency and security. It can significantly improve occupant experiences as nicely. For occasion, smart lighting methods can adjust routinely primarily based on the time of day or occupancy levels. Climate controls could be personalised, providing tailored environments for different areas of the building. Such features lead to increased consolation, productivity, and satisfaction among occupants.


Collaboration amongst numerous techniques is crucial for optimizing building efficiency. IoT connectivity facilitates seamless communication between disparate technologies. A smart thermostat can work in tandem with an occupancy sensor to regulate heating and cooling based on real-time occupancy. Integration like this ensures that resources are used efficiently whereas enhancing person experiences.


Incorporating IoT connectivity can initially appear daunting for building house owners because of the upfront prices and the technological complexity. However, the long-term savings and operational advantages usually far exceed the preliminary investments. Property homeowners can even profit from elevated asset worth, as smart buildings are increasingly in demand among tenants seeking modern, efficient facilities.

A pivotal consideration when implementing IoT connectivity is information privacy and security. As buildings turn out to be extra interconnected, the potential for safety breaches increases. It is significant for constructing managers to adopt sturdy cybersecurity measures to protect delicate information. Implementing encryption protocols, common software updates, and strict entry controls can considerably improve the safety of constructing automation techniques.


The way forward for constructing automation methods is undoubtedly tied to the evolution of IoT connectivity. New technologies continuously emerge, offering progressive methods to integrate and optimize constructing operations. The creation of 5G technology, for example, is about to revolutionize how devices communicate - Benefits Of Remote Access Iot Devices. Enhanced information speeds and decreased latency will help more superior functions, including virtual and augmented reality tools for building management and design.


Sustainability additionally plays an important position within the dialogue around IoT connectivity in constructing automation techniques. Energy management methods powered by IoT can actively monitor consumption patterns and implement methods to reduce waste. The capacity to evaluate energy usage this content in real-time allows managers to adopt more sustainable practices. These efforts contribute considerably to company social responsibility targets and regulatory compliance.


The collaboration between manufacturers, technology suppliers, and end-users is crucial for the successful deployment of IoT in constructing automation methods. Each stakeholder performs a big position in ensuring that the systems are not solely efficient but in addition user-friendly. Training for workers and occupants on tips on how to use these advanced instruments can enhance general adoption and maximize benefits.

How does IoT improve energy management in buildings?

IoT enhances energy management by providing real-time information on energy usage, enabling automated control of HVAC, lighting, and other techniques. This leads to optimized performance, reduced waste, and decrease energy prices, all while maintaining occupant comfort.


What are the security concerns associated to IoT connectivity in building automation?


Security considerations include potential vulnerabilities in related gadgets, knowledge breaches, and unauthorized access to constructing systems. Implementing sturdy encryption, common updates, and a sturdy cybersecurity technique may help mitigate these dangers.

Can IoT connectivity help in predictive maintenance for constructing systems?


Yes, IoT connectivity allows predictive maintenance through the use of sensors to observe tools performance in real-time. This knowledge can predict potential failures, permitting for well timed maintenance earlier than points escalate, thereby lowering downtime and maintenance costs.

What forms of devices are commonly used in IoT building automation systems?


Common units embrace smart thermostats, lighting controls, security cameras, occupancy sensors, and energy meters. These units talk over IoT protocols to streamline constructing management and improve operational effectivity.
